Weatherford International plc, an energy services company, provides equipment and services for the drilling, evaluation, completion, production, and intervention of oil, geothermal, and natural gas wells wor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Drilling and Evaluation; Well Construction and Completions; and Production and Intervention. It offers managed pressure drilling; directional drilling services, and logging and measurement services while drilling; services related to rotary-steerable systems, high temperature and high pressure sensors, drilling reamers, and circulation subs; open-hole and cased-hole logging services; wireline and drilling fluids; and intervention and remediation services. The company also provides tubular handling, management, and connection services; cementing products, including plugs, float and stage equipment, and torque-and-drag reduction technology for zonal isolation; completion tools, such as safety valves, production packers, downhole reservoir monitoring, flow control, isolation packers, multistage fracturing systems and sand-control technologies; liner hangers to suspend a casing string in high-temperature and high-pressure wells; and well Services. In addition, it offers re-entry, fishing, and well abandonment services, as well as patented downhole tools, tubular-handling equipment, pressure-control equipment, and drill pipe and tubulars; artificial lift systems, including reciprocating rod, progressing cavity pumping, and related automation and control systems, as well as gas, hydraulic, plunger, and hybrid lift systems, as well as related automation and control systems; and software, automation and flow measurement solutions. Further, it provides electrical and hydraulic power transmission to subsea equipment; and pressure pumping and reservoir stimulation services, such as acidizing, fracturing, cementing, and coiled-tubing intervention. The company was incorporated in 1972 and is based in Houston, Texas.
